[llvm-commits] CVS: llvm/test/Regression/Transforms/InstCombine/cast.ll

Chris Lattner lattner at cs.uiuc.edu
Mon Jul 19 17:57:31 PDT 2004



Changes in directory llvm/test/Regression/Transforms/InstCombine:

cast.ll updated: 1.20 -> 1.21

---
Log message:

Testcases missed by the instruction combiner


---
Diffs of the changes:  (+14 -0)

Index: llvm/test/Regression/Transforms/InstCombine/cast.ll
diff -u llvm/test/Regression/Transforms/InstCombine/cast.ll:1.20 llvm/test/Regression/Transforms/InstCombine/cast.ll:1.21
--- llvm/test/Regression/Transforms/InstCombine/cast.ll:1.20	Mon May 24 23:28:43 2004
+++ llvm/test/Regression/Transforms/InstCombine/cast.ll	Mon Jul 19 19:57:21 2004
@@ -103,3 +103,17 @@
 	%c = cast int* %P to bool  ;; setne P, null
 	ret bool %c
 }
+
+
+short %test17(bool %tmp3) {
+	%c = cast bool %tmp3 to int
+	%t86 = cast int %c to short
+	ret short %t86
+}
+
+short %test18(sbyte %tmp3) {
+	%c = cast sbyte %tmp3 to int
+	%t86 = cast int %c to short
+	ret short %t86
+}
+





More information about the llvm-commits mailing list